Saturday Update:
The Point Loma called in with 32 Dorado, 1 Yellowtail and 1 Yellowfin tuna.

The Mission Belle called in with 60 Dorado and 3 Bluefin Tuna for their Full Day CA Offshore trip. 

The Daily Double came back from their AM 1/2 day trip with 25 Rockfish, 2 Calico Bass, 13 Sand Bass and 1 Sheephead. 

The Success returned from a 2.5 Day trip with 40 Bluefin Tuna, 14 Yellowtail, 5 Rockfish, 2 Yellowfin Tuna and 1 Dorado.

The New Lo-An called in from the water with LIMITS of Bluefin Tuna for their 3 day trip for 20 anglers. Half of these fish are 20-40 lbs and half are 60-160 lbs.

Recommended tackle for any of these trips would include a 30# live bait rod, 50# bait/jig rod and a heavy outfit with 80# or 100# for sinker rigs / knife jigs.
